Advancing Careers in Public Safety and Strategic Security

Public safety professionals play a vital role in every community. From police departments and fire services to emergency management and cybersecurity, these roles often require a level of dedication and resilience that few truly understand.

But for many in the field, especially those looking to move into supervisory or leadership positions, experience alone is no longer enough. Credentials matter. Henley-Putnam School of Strategic Security at National American University can help train students for those opportunities.

“Our students come to us with real-world experience, but they want more. They want the skills, tools and education that allow them to lead,” said Dr. Susie Kuilan, lead faculty member at Henley-Putnam. “They want to rise into roles where they can shape policy, train others or manage entire operations.”

Henley-Putnam’s programs are fully online and designed with flexibility in mind. Students can choose from undergraduate, graduate or doctoral programs in areas like Intelligence Management, Strategic Security and Protection, and Terrorism and Counterterrorism Studies. Each program is designed to meet the needs of working adults who want to earn a degree while continuing their careers.

Dr. Barbara Burke, the school’s dean, said the programs are ideal for professionals looking to step into leadership positions without relocating or taking time away from their jobs.

“We see students across South Dakota and beyond who are working full-time and raising families,” Burke said. “They know that advancing their education can open doors, but they need a format that works with their lives. That’s what we provide.”

For police officers, first responders, military reservists and even corporate security professionals, these credentials can help turn on-the-ground experience into leadership opportunities. Whether the goal is a promotion, a shift into the intelligence community or a transition into federal or private-sector roles, the training offered through Henley-Putnam is structured to support those ambitions.

“It’s not just about earning a degree,” Kuilan noted. “It’s about training to become the kind of leader others rely on in moments of crisis and complexity.”
